The Life of GERALD EDWARD TAYLOR

Gerald Taylor, 75, passed away Saturday, January 26, 2013, at Iowa Methodist Medical Center in Des Moines. The body has been cremated and private family services were held at Westover Chapel. G.T. was born in Minburn and lived in Des Moines most of his life. He worked at John Deere for 37 years as a laborer and U.A.W. Union Representative, retiring in 1994. G.T. also worked at Lutheran Social Service for a short time. In retirement he started his own construction/handyman business with his son, Jeff. He also constructed several houses in the Saylorville area. G.T. enjoyed horse racing and gaming in his spare time and carpentry projects with his sons. G.T. is survived by his wife of 34 years, Betty, his children, Jeff Taylor, Mark Taylor, Diane T. (Jeff Blanchard) Hoffman, Rene (Mark) Harrison and Deb (Ron) Carlson; grandchildren, Michelle, Abigail, Lily, Amy, Jessica, Angela and Erin; three great grandchildren, and his siblings, John Taylor and Wayne Taylor.
